Annual Forecasts to 2010 for the World's Sports and Energy Drinks Market.


DUBLIN, Ireland -- Research and Markets (http://www.researchandmarkets.com/reports/c43693) has announced the addition of Sports and Energy Drinks - Global Strategic Business Report to their offering.

This report analyzes the worldwide markets for Sports and Energy Drinks in Millions of US$. The specific product segments analyzed are Sports Drinks, and Energy Drinks. The report provides separate comprehensive analytics for the US, Canada, Japan,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and Rest of World. Annual forecasts are provided for each region for the period of 2000 through 2010.
